What is Psychotherapy?

Psychotherapy, often called therapy or counseling, is a professional mental health service in which you meet regularly with a licensed therapist to address emotional, behavioral, or psychological concerns. Unlike casual conversations with friends or family, psychotherapy is guided by clinical training, ethical standards, and proven therapeutic methods.

The goal is not simply to talk about problems. Psychotherapy helps you recognize patterns in how you think, react, and relate to others. Many people discover that their current struggles are connected to learned coping habits, past experiences, or automatic thought processes that operate outside of conscious awareness.

Psychotherapy can address both specific mental health conditions and general life concerns. Some clients come to therapy during a difficult period, while others seek personal development, emotional insight, or better stress management. Regardless of the reason, therapy provides a structured environment for ongoing growth.

How Does Psychotherapy Work?

Psychotherapy works through a combination of professional guidance, self-reflection, and skill-building. The process begins with a thorough understanding of your experiences, current difficulties, and goals. Your therapist will collaborate with you to create a treatment plan tailored to your needs rather than applying a one-size-fits-all approach.

Furthermore, a central part of therapy is identifying patterns. People often repeat certain thoughts or reactions automatically. Examples may include expecting failure, avoiding conflict, overthinking decisions, or suppressing emotions. These patterns can contribute to anxiety, depression, and relationship difficulties.

While in individual therapy, you may learn techniques for calming anxiety, improving communication, managing intrusive thoughts, or setting boundaries. Eventually, these tools become habits. Therapy does not just relieve symptoms temporarily. It helps you build long-term skills for managing mental health challenges.

The therapeutic relationship also matters. When you feel safe and supported, you are better able to explore difficult emotions honestly. As insight grows, people often report feeling more in control of their decisions and less controlled by stress or emotional reactions.

How Do I Know I Need Psychotherapy?

Many individuals delay therapy because they think their problems are not severe enough. In reality, therapy is appropriate whenever your emotional well-being or daily functioning is affected. Additionally, therapy is preventative as well as restorative. Seeking help early can prevent symptoms from worsening and improve long-term mental health. What Should I Expect In A Therapy Session?

Your first appointment focuses on understanding you. Your therapist will ask about your current concerns, personal history, stressors, and goals for therapy. You will also have the opportunity to ask questions and discuss preferences. Ongoing sessions typically last an hour and may include:

It is also important to note that you control the pace. You are never required to share more than you feel comfortable discussing. Generally, many clients find that sessions become easier and more productive as trust develops between them and their therapists.

Additionally, therapists may suggest optional between-session exercises such as journaling, mindfulness practice, or applying a communication strategy in real life.
